    129, 21ST AVENUE, HULL, HU6 8HD

    This terraced freehold property on 21st Avenue last sold in June 2022 for £100,000. Based on price growth in the HU6 district since then, its estimated current value is £106,519 — placing it in the 5th percentile nationally and the 24th percentile within HU6. The property covers 73 m² (786 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,459 per m². The EPC rating is B, with a potential rating of B.
